The Fusion of Solar Tech and Micro-Living
Modern solar powered tiny homes integrate high-efficiency photovoltaic panels (22%+ conversion rates) with lithium-ion battery systems. A typical 400 sq.ft. unit can generate 10-15 kWh daily – enough to power appliances, heating, and even EV charging stations. In sun-rich regions like California or Australia’s Outback, some models achieve full energy autonomy for 300+ days a year.

3 Burning Questions Answered
Q: How often do solar systems need maintenance?
A: Modern panels require only bi-annual cleaning, with most batteries lasting 10+ years.
Q: Can these homes withstand extreme weather?
A> Hurricane-resistant models in Florida have survived 150 mph winds through anchored solar foundations.
Q: What’s the payback period for installation costs?
A> Most users break even within 6-8 years through energy savings and tax incentives.
